Mass revolving around another mass in 2D

Hello all,

I have some pretty severe problems with letting a small mass rotate around a large mass. The large mass may only move up and down, while the small mass rotates around the center of the large mass at a constant distance (e.g. connected via a massless chain or a rope).

I understand that for letting the small mass revolve around the large mass, I have to create a RP at the center of the large mass and use a kinematic coupling constraint with the surface of the small mass. Then, I create a BC and let the RP rotate - the small mass then revolves around the large mass.

HOWEVER, the large mass is not affected by the movement of the small mass whatsoever.

I tried a lot of things, but I think my main problems lie here:

- How do I connect both masses in the right way so that the motion of the small mass influences the large mass? What connectors are needed here, if any? I think I tried all of them..

- Or, how do I tell Abaqus to take over the RP motion in y-direction for the large mass, but only the motion in y-direction? As mentioned before, the large mass may not rotate itself or move in x-direction.

I would be very thankful for any advice.

Thank you very much in advance!!